What are the common signs and symptoms of gender dysphoria in adults, and how can it be effectively diagnosed and treated"?

Common signs and symptoms of gender dysphoria in adults include feeling uncomfortable with one's assigned gender, a strong desire to be a different gender, and distress related to one's gender identity. Gender dysphoria can be effectively diagnosed by mental health professionals through assessments and discussions. Treatment options may include therapy, hormone therapy, and gender-affirming surgeries, tailored to the individual's needs and preferences.

What can nicotine do to your body and overall health?

Nicotine can have harmful effects on your body and overall health. It can increase heart rate and blood pressure, constrict blood vessels, and lead to addiction. Long-term use of nicotine can increase the risk of heart disease, stroke, and respiratory issues. It can also harm the developing brains of adolescents and young adults.

Why are adolescents advised to take more calcium than adults?

Adolescents are advised to take more calcium than the adults because they are still growing and calcium is essential for their bone and teeth development.
